Can immigrants acquire a driver's license in Poland?
Yes, foreigners residing in Poland can acquire a driver's license. Nevertheless, they should fulfill the exact same requirements as Polish nationals, consisting of passing the necessary examinations.
2. For how long is the driver's license legitimate in Poland?
A Polish driver's license stands for Koszt Prawa jazdy w Polsce 15 years from the date of issue. After this period, it must be restored.
3. Do I need to take a driving course if I currently have a foreign license?
If you hold a legitimate driver's license released by another EU member state, you can generally use it in Poland. Nevertheless, if you have a non-EU license, you may need to pass an examination to acquire a Polish license.
